Coffee on the Moon is a community-rooted café in downtown Duncan that has been a local gathering place since 1997, serving espresso drinks, teas, smoothies, and a food menu including bagels, paninis, salads, and baked goods with v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options. The café doubles as a rotating gallery space for Cowichan Valley artists, giving it a distinctive neighbourhood character.
